What is the difference between titanium, quartz, and ceramic nails?

ll nails offer a unique experience in their own way. Our grade 2 Titanium nails are the strongest of the nails, however they should be replaced yearly due to oxidization. Titanium also offers a lot of universal options for the consumer looking for a nail to fit multiple ground joint sizes.
Quartz crystal is a material that visually looks like glass, however quartz has a much higher tolerance to heat, compared to borosilicate glass. Quartz nails stay hot longer, and are much more efficient for those seeking a low temperature experience.
Ceramic nails are best known for getting the most flavors out of your essential oils. As long as a ceramic nail is heated properly and evenly, they often last as long as 6 months before needing to be replaced.
